UK single release: Something/Come Together

In the United Kingdom, The Beatles had never previously issued songs after they had been made available on an album. All singles were either standalone releases, or came out on the same day as the parent album.

US album release: Abbey Road

Five days after its UK release, The Beatles' last-recorded LP, Abbey Road, was issued in the United States on this day. The catalog number was Apple SO 383.

UK album release: Abbey Road

The Beatles' 12th official album, Abbey Road, was released in the UK on this day. Their last-recorded album, it was issued only in stereo, as Apple PCS 7088.

US album release: Electronic Sound by George Harrison

The Beatles' experimental label Zapple Records was launched in the US on this day, with the release of two albums: George Harrison's Electronic Sound and John Lennon and Yoko Ono's Unfinished Music No 2: Life With The Lions.

US single release: Get Back

Nearly a month after its release in the United Kingdom, The Beatles' first single of 1969 was issued in the United States.

UK single release: Get Back

The Beatles' 19th British single, and their first for 1969, was Get Back, with Don't Let Me Down on the b-side.

US album release: Yellow Submarine

The soundtrack LP for The Beatles' animated film Yellow Submarine was released in the United States on this day, with six songs by the group and seven orchestral pieces by George Martin.
